pespin has uploaded this change for review.
rlcmac: llc_queue: Fix access to null msgb during dequeue
Change-Id: I513aaef6ad0f44b5a6d32be512bdd8b4fdabb4e7
---
M src/rlcmac/llc_queue.c
1 file changed, 3 insertions(+), 1 deletion(-)
git pull ssh://gerrit.osmocom.org:29418/libosmo-gprs refs/changes/42/31342/1
diff --git a/src/rlcmac/llc_queue.c b/src/rlcmac/llc_queue.c
index 2643b66..2c1aeea 100644
--- a/src/rlcmac/llc_queue.c
+++ b/src/rlcmac/llc_queue.c
@@ -207,7 +207,9 @@
"new_queue_size=%zu\n", frames, octets, gprs_rlcmac_llc_queue_size(q));
}
- msgb_pull_to_l2(msg);
+ if (!msg)
+ return NULL;
+ msgb_pull_to_l2(msg);
return msg;
}
To view, visit change 31342. To unsubscribe, or for help writing mail filters, visit settings.